Crane Lake, Northwest Territories (1901 census)

Crane Lake was a census subdivision in Northwest Territories, recorded in the 1901 Census of Canada with a population of 247. The administrative centroid was at approximately 49.873°N, 108.998°W.

Population

In 1901, Crane Lake had a population of 247: 160 male and 87 female residents. Population density was 0.3 people per square mile.
